    I am amazed that is has been 25 years since then. We, Warner Giles and I were on our way to Oskosh and stopped in Sioux City. It was shortly after the crash and there were flowers that people had put near the fence in in the fence that looked out on the site.
    It is too bad they could not have made the longer runway, but they did the best they could and saved a lot of people.
    My friend is a United pilot and after the accident they tried to control the plane in the simulator, and almost no one could at first, but they did get the hang of it to some extent.
